LAVERNE BATES
ADA-Services for LaVerne Ruth Bates, 84, of Ada, are 10:00 a.m. Saturday at the Oak Avenue Baptist Church, Rev. Ray Talbott will officiate. Burial will follow at Memorial Park Cemetery. The family will receive friends from 6:00 p.m. until 8:00 p.m. Friday at Criswell Funeral Home.
Mrs. Bates died Sunday, July 14, 2013 in a Dallas, TX hospital. She was born in Ada, Oklahoma on June 13, 1929 to Augustus G. Gaar, Sr. and Gladys Faye Griffith Gaar. She graduated from Horace Mann High School and attended East Central University, the University of Oklahoma in Norman, and Oklahoma State University in Stillwater.
She married Charles Thomas Bates, Jr. on June 20, 1948. He preceded her in death on September 20, 2006. Mrs. Bates was a homemaker and a longtime member of Oak Avenue Baptist Church. She was also a member of College Heights Baptist Church in Manhattan, Kansas, where she resided for 28 years. Mrs. Bates was an active member of the P.E. O. Sisterhood for over 60 years, and a Charter member of the G. U. Chapter of Manhattan, Kansas. She was a former president of the Christian Women's Club at Kansas State University.
Survivors include two sons, Dennis C. Bates of Amesbury, MA, and Byron T. Bates of Southlake, TX; one grandchild, Brandon C. Bates of Southlake, TX; one brother, Augustus G. Gaar, Jr. of Stratford; three nephews, Ashley Gaar, Stratford, Kenneth Gaar, Texas, and Keith Gaar, Texas; two nieces, Dr. Kathy Gaar, Florida and Dr. Karla Gaar, Texas.
She was preceded in death by her parents; her husband, Charles T. Bates, Jr.; one brother, Dr. Basil Gaar, Houston, TX; and one sister, Iris Faye Gaar, Ada.
Bearers will be David Eidson, Hob Robinson, Billy Young, Chris Geisler, Mike Tuley and Ruy Da Costa Lima.
